Sangakkara, Murali shatter Bangladesh dream

Man of the match Kumar Sangakkara cracked a solid 59 and Muttiah Muralitharan hammered 33 off 16 balls as Sri Lanka's cricketers clinched a thrilling two-wicket win over Bangladesh in the tri-series final in Mirpur.

Sri Lanka made a horror start when they lost five wickets for six runs - the lowest score at the fall of the fifth wicket in the history of the one-day game - before surpassing Bangladesh's total of 152 with 11 balls to spare.

Bangladesh's Shakib Al Hasan was named man of the tournament, which was played with Zimbabwe as well as Sri Lanka and the hosts.
